Poppy Ott's SEVEN LEAGUE STILTS
by Leo Edwards
Copyright, 1926, by Grosset Dunlap
Leo Edwards was a born story teller. If you have ever read any of his books, you will have to agree they are full of laughs on every page. This is #2 in the Poppy Ott series. Join in on the fun, mystery, and adventure!
This book lists to "Jerry Todd, Editor-In-Grief" (1930), "Poppy Ott and the Prancing Pancake" (1930), "Andy Blake and the Pot of Gold" (1930), and "Trigger Berg and His 700 Mouse Traps" (1930). It has plain endpapers. It has a glossy frontispiece and three glossy internal illustrations. It is a 1930 edition in good condition.
